Strategic Design

Meaning

Strategic Design, in the context of hormonal health, refers to the rigorous, evidence-based, and highly individualized process of formulating a multi-modal therapeutic protocol. This design is founded upon comprehensive biomarker data and mechanistic clarity, ensuring all interventions are logically sequenced and synergistically aligned to achieve specific, quantifiable physiological goals. It is the architectural phase of personalized medicine, where the clinician moves from diagnostic data to a coherent, executable plan. The design ensures that all elements, from nutrition to hormonal modulation, work in concert.
